1. HIIT It Hard (But Not Too Long)

I know, I know. You’ve heard this before: “Try High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T)!” But trust me, this stuff works — and you don’t even have to spend hours doing it. HIIT is all about short bursts of all-out effort followed by a quick recovery. You’ll burn calories like crazy, and the best part? You’re done in 20–30 minutes. That’s like the length of a Netflix episode — except instead of sitting on the couch, you’re burning fat and getting faster.

Try sprint intervals, jump squats, or even burpees (I know, they’re evil, but they work). Your heart rate will soar, you’ll feel like a beast, and you’ll get fit without living at the gym.
